Enhancing haptic object recognition ability through a real multisensory learning environment

Summary
Active learning enhances object recognition. Multisensory direct access to object shape, incorporating visual information, improved haptic recognition accuracy compared to haptic-only experiences.
Area of Science:
- Cognitive psychology
- Neuroscience
- Human-computer interaction
Background:
- Active learning, involving control over sensory input, improves visual object recognition.
- Multisensory active experiences, combining vision and haptics, also enhance object recognition compared to passive or screen-based visual encoding.
Purpose of the Study:
- To investigate the impact of multisensory control, direct sensory access, and experience ownership on haptic object recognition.
- To determine if the source of visual information (direct environment vs. screen) affects haptic recognition.
Main Methods:
- Participants engaged in active learning scenarios involving real 3D objects with varying levels of visual and haptic input.
- Haptic object recognition accuracy was measured under different conditions of sensory access and visual information presentation.
Main Results:
- Multisensory direct access to object shape significantly improved haptic recognition accuracy compared to haptic-only conditions.
- The source of visual object structure information (direct environment or computer screen) did not influence haptic recognition performance.
Conclusions:
- Visual information is crucial for haptic object recognition within a multisensory context.
- Direct environmental sensory access, rather than screen-based presentation, is key for leveraging visual input in multisensory haptic learning.

Albert Bandura's observational learning, also known as imitation or modeling, occurs when a person observes and imitates another's behavior. It is a quicker process than operant conditioning. A well-known example is the Bobo doll study, where children who saw an adult acting aggressively towards the doll were more likely to act aggressively when left alone, compared to those who observed a nonaggressive adult.
